Why organic climate farming matters
Organic climate farming brings together organic principles with climate farming practices, supporting mitigation, adaptation and co-benefits such as healthier soils, biodiversity and resilience. OrganicClimateNET is designed to help translate that potential into practical support for farmers.
To do that, the project is not only building a network. It is also developing useful resources. More than 120 climate and carbon knowledge materials will be adapted and translated, feeding into a decision-support toolbox made accessible through the Organic Farm Knowledge Platform. The project also includes peer-to-peer learning, carbon assessments, climate strategies for farms, and policy-oriented outputs that can help inform future action.

A complementary example from horticulture
At the same time, climate action in agriculture also requires targeted innovation in specific sectors. In horticulture, one of those challenges is peat dependence.
That is where PEATLESS, another EU-funded project, offers a complementary example. PEATLESS is working to reduce peat use in horticulture by developing and validating alternative substrates, with demonstration activities in several European regions, and has just launched its first campaign focused on La Rioja. It shows how one concrete environmental challenge can be addressed through research, validation and grower engagement.
